Output 2757c97256fe881c131aa09ea8520e8411ed8aea2d3ab317095ee0eef05b0d26:48

value
42098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1224444f03c0d867988ecdffe602abb23fc2bc9 OP_EQUAL
address
3KJDPTVCsLkze9wSwZgded2kkchDMuEC4W
transaction
2757c97256fe881c131aa09ea8520e8411ed8aea2d3ab317095ee0eef05b0d26
confirmations
244749
spent
true